Output 39addcc5efc25c1fdcf637d1e1623bb38ff1a872eb402552551b51ead32f4994:57

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 624a700494e176659ce5ee3a1bdadedbc792de30598e9b716c614ef093a2cea9
address
bc1pvf98qpy5u9mxt889acaphkk7m0re9h3stx8fkutvv980pyaze65s23pssh
transaction
39addcc5efc25c1fdcf637d1e1623bb38ff1a872eb402552551b51ead32f4994
spent
true